A Windows operációs rendszer, amely mindennapjaink szerves részévé vált, rengeteg fájlt és mappát kezel a háttérben. Ezek egy része könnyedén hozzáférhető a Fájlkezelőn keresztül, de vannak olyanok, amelyek „láthatatlanok” maradnak a puszta szem számára. Ezeket a rejtett struktúrákat nevezhetjük „láthatatlan könyvtáraknak” – olyan speciális mappáknak és rendszerelemeknek, amelyek kulcsfontosságúak az operációs rendszer és az alkalmazások megfelelő működéséhez. Cikkünkben felfedezzük, miért vannak ezek a könyvtárak elrejtve, melyek a leggyakoribbak, és hogyan tudjuk őket megjeleníteni és biztonságosan kezelni a Windowsban.
Miért rejtőznek el a fájlok és könyvtárak?
A „láthatatlanság” nem véletlen funkció, hanem tudatos tervezés eredménye. Ennek több oka is van:
- Rendszerintegritás és stabilitás: A rejtett fájlok és mappák nagy része az operációs rendszer és a telepített programok alapvető működéséért felelős. Véletlen törlésük vagy módosításuk súlyos rendszerhibákhoz, adatvesztéshez vagy akár a Windows működésképtelenségéhez vezethet. Az elrejtés egyfajta „védőháló”, amely megóvja a felhasználót az akaratlan károkozástól.
- Egyszerűség és áttekinthetőség: Képzeljük el, ha a Fájlkezelőben minden egyes rendszerszintű és programfájl látható lenne. A felhasználói felület zsúfolt és átláthatatlan lenne, megnehezítve a fontosabb, személyes fájlok megtalálását. A rejtett elemekkel a Windows letisztultabb és könnyebben kezelhető marad a hétköznapi felhasználók számára.
- Adatvédelem és biztonság: Bizonyos rejtett mappák érzékeny felhasználói adatokat, beállításokat vagy gyorsítótárakat tartalmaznak. Bár ez elsősorban a felhasználói hozzáférési jogokkal biztosított, a rejtett attribútum további réteget ad a nem kívánt hozzáférés elleni védelemben.
A rejtett fájlok és mappák tehát nem valami titokzatos vagy rosszindulatú dolog, hanem egy logikus és szükséges eleme a modern operációs rendszerek tervezésének.
A „könyvtárak” fogalma Windowsban – és a láthatatlan kiterjesztés
Mielőtt mélyebben belemerülnénk a rejtett elemekbe, tisztázzuk a „könyvtárak” fogalmát Windows környezetben. A Windows 7 óta létező „Könyvtárak” (például Dokumentumok, Képek, Videók) valójában logikai gyűjtemények, amelyek több fizikai mappából származó tartalmat képesek megjeleníteni. Ezek a könyvtárak alapértelmezés szerint láthatók és könnyen kezelhetők.
Amikor azonban „láthatatlan könyvtárakról” beszélünk, akkor általában azokra a rejtett mappákra és rendszerkönyvtárakra utalunk, amelyek nem közvetlenül jelennek meg a Fájlkezelőben, de elengedhetetlenek a Windows és az alkalmazások futásához. Ezek a mappák tartalmazzák a programok beállításait, felhasználói profilokat, ideiglenes fájlokat és az operációs rendszer magját.
A leggyakoribb „láthatatlan” könyvtárak és mappák
Számos ilyen „láthatatlan könyvtár” létezik a Windowsban. Íme a legfontosabbak:
AppData
mappa: Ez valószínűleg a leggyakrabban emlegetett rejtett mappa, amely a felhasználói profil könyvtárában található (példáulC:UsersFelhasználóNeveAppData
). Három almappát tartalmaz:Roaming
: Azok a beállítások és adatok, amelyek ideális esetben szinkronizálódnak különböző számítógépek között (pl. szerver alapú profilos környezetben).Local
: Azok a programadatok, amelyek csak az adott számítógépre vonatkoznak, és nem szinkronizálódnak (pl. nagy méretű gyorsítótárak).LocalLow
: Alacsony integritású alkalmazások (pl. böngészők védett módban futó plug-injei) adatai, amelyek kevesebb jogosultsággal futnak.
Az
AppData
mappa kritikus fontosságú az alkalmazások működéséhez, hiszen itt tárolódnak a felhasználói beállítások, a mentett játékállások, a böngészők előzményei és a programok gyorsítótárai.ProgramData
mappa: Ez a mappa aC:ProgramData
útvonalon található, és a számítógép összes felhasználója számára elérhető alkalmazásadatokat tárolja. Hasonló azAppData
-hoz, de globálisabb jellegű. Itt találhatók a programok közös beállításai, licencei és egyéb adatai.Windows
mappa: AC:Windows
könyvtár a Windows operációs rendszer szíve. Itt találhatók a rendszerfájlok, illesztőprogramok, a Registry adatbázisának részei és minden, ami az OS futásához szükséges. Ezt a mappát rendkívül körültekintően kell kezelni, mivel bármilyen módosítás súlyos rendszerhibákhoz vezethet.System32
mappa: AC:WindowsSystem32
almappa elengedhetetlen a Windows működéséhez, és a rendszer legfontosabb DLL fájljait és végrehajtható programjait tartalmazza.$Recycle.Bin
mappa: Ez a mappa az egyes meghajtók gyökerében található, és a Lomtár tényleges tartalmát tárolja. Láthatatlanná tétele megakadályozza, hogy a felhasználó közvetlenül hozzáférjen a törölt fájlokhoz a Lomtár felületének megkerülésével.System Volume Information
mappa: Szintén az egyes meghajtók gyökerében található rejtett mappa, amely a Rendszer-visszaállítási pontokat és az Indexelési szolgáltatás adatbázisait tartalmazza. Nagyon fontos a rendszer stabilitásának és a visszaállítási pontoknak a szempontjából.- Ideiglenes fájlok (Temp): A
%TEMP%
vagy%TMP%
környezeti változóval elérhető mappák (általában azAppDataLocalTemp
vagy aC:WindowsTemp
alatt) ideiglenes fájlokat tárolnak, amelyeket a programok hoznak létre működésük során. Ezek felhalmozódhatnak, és idővel jelentős lemezterületet foglalhatnak el.
A láthatatlan könyvtárak megjelenítése és kezelése
A „láthatatlan” címke ellenére, a Windows számos eszközt biztosít a rejtett fájlok és mappák megjelenítésére és kezelésére. Fontos megjegyezni, hogy ezeket az opciókat csak akkor használjuk, ha tudjuk, mit csinálunk!
1. A Fájlkezelő beállításai
Ez a legegyszerűbb és leggyakoribb módja a rejtett elemek láthatóvá tételének:
- Nyissuk meg a Fájlkezelőt (Windows + E).
- A felső menüszalagon kattintsunk a Nézet fülre.
- A Megjelenítés/Elrejtés csoportban pipáljuk be a Rejtett elemek négyzetet. Ez azonnal láthatóvá teszi a legtöbb rejtett fájlt és mappát (mint például az
AppData
). - A védett rendszerfájlok megjelenítéséhez ennél többre van szükség:
- Ugyanitt, a Nézet fülön kattintsunk a Beállítások (vagy Opciók) gombra, majd válasszuk a Mappa- és keresési beállítások módosítása lehetőséget.
- A felugró ablakban válasszuk a Nézet fület.
- Görgessünk le a Speciális beállítások listában.
- Keressük meg a Védett operációs rendszerfájlok elrejtése (ajánlott) opciót, és vegyük ki a pipát mellőle.
- A felugró figyelmeztetésre kattintsunk az Igen gombra.
- Kattintsunk az Alkalmaz, majd az OK gombra.
Ezek után a rendszerfájlok, mint a System Volume Information
vagy a $Recycle.Bin
, is láthatóvá válnak.
2. Parancssor (CMD) használata
A parancssor (CMD) hatékony eszköz a fájlattribútumok kezelésére, beleértve a rejtett és rendszerfájl attribútumokat is. Nyissuk meg a parancssort rendszergazdaként (keresőbe írjuk be: cmd
, majd jobb egérgomb -> Futtatás rendszergazdaként).
- Mappa tartalmának megjelenítése attribútumokkal:
dir /a <útvonal>
Például:
dir /a C:UsersFelhasználóNeve
Ez listázza az adott könyvtár összes fájlját és mappáját, beleértve a rejtetteket (H
) és a rendszerfájlokat (S
) is. - Fájl/mappa attribútumainak megváltoztatása az
ATTRIB
paranccsal:
AzATTRIB
paranccsal beállíthatjuk vagy eltávolíthatjuk a fájlok és mappák attribútumait.+H
: Rejtett attribútum beállítása-H
: Rejtett attribútum eltávolítása+S
: Rendszer attribútum beállítása-S
: Rendszer attribútum eltávolítása+R
: Csak olvasható attribútum beállítása-R
: Csak olvasható attribútum eltávolítása/S
: Almappákra és fájljaikra is alkalmazza/D
: Mappákat is feldolgozza
Példák:
Mappa elrejtése:attrib +h "C:SajatFontosMappa"
Rejtett mappa megjelenítése:attrib -h "C:SajatFontosMappa"
Mappa elrejtése rendszerfájlként (erősebb elrejtés):attrib +h +s "C:SajatRendszerMappa"
Rejtett rendszermappa megjelenítése:attrib -h -s "C:SajatRendszerMappa"
3. PowerShell használata
A PowerShell, a Windows fejlettebb parancssori felülete, még nagyobb rugalmasságot kínál. Nyissuk meg a PowerShellt rendszergazdaként (keresőbe írjuk be: powershell
, majd jobb egérgomb -> Futtatás rendszergazdaként).
- Rejtett elemek listázása:
Get-ChildItem -Path <útvonal> -Force
A
-Force
paraméter kényszeríti a rejtett és rendszerfájlok megjelenítését.
Például:Get-ChildItem -Path "C:UsersFelhasználóNeve" -Force
- Attribútumok módosítása:
Set-ItemProperty -LiteralPath <útvonal> -Name Attributes -Value ([System.IO.FileAttributes]::Hidden + [System.IO.FileAttributes]::System)
Ez a parancs beállítja a rejtett és rendszer attribútumokat.
Például, egy mappa elrejtéséhez:
Set-ItemProperty -LiteralPath "C:SajatMappa" -Name Attributes -Value ([System.IO.FileAttributes]::Hidden)
Egy mappa megjelenítéséhez (rejtett attribútum eltávolítása):
Set-ItemProperty -LiteralPath "C:SajatMappa" -Name Attributes -Value 0
(a 0 visszaállítja az alapértelmezett állapotot, azaz eltávolítja az összes speciális attribútumot, amennyiben nem voltak mások beállítva).
Alternatívaként:
Set-ItemProperty -LiteralPath "C:SajatMappa" -Name Attributes -Value ([System.IO.FileAttributes]::Normal)
4. Speciális mappák elérése
Néhány rejtett mappa könnyen elérhető környezeti változók segítségével. Ezeket beírhatjuk a Fájlkezelő címsorába vagy a „Futtatás” ablakba (Windows + R):
%APPDATA%
: Egyenesen azAppDataRoaming
mappába visz.%LOCALAPPDATA%
: AzAppDataLocal
mappába navigál.%TEMP%
: Az ideiglenes fájlok mappájába visz (általábanAppDataLocalTemp
).%PROGRAMDATA%
: AProgramData
mappába navigál.
Mikor van szükség láthatatlan könyvtárak kezelésére?
Bár a legtöbb felhasználónak sosem kell foglalkoznia ezekkel a mappákkal, bizonyos esetekben elengedhetetlen a hozzáférésük:
- Hibaelhárítás: Ha egy program furcsán viselkedik, vagy nem indul el, érdemes lehet az
AppData
mappában található beállításait vagy gyorsítótárait törölni. Gyakran ez megoldja a problémát anélkül, hogy a teljes programot újratelepítenénk. - Tárhely felszabadítás: Az ideiglenes fájlok (
%TEMP%
) és egyes programok gyorsítótárai (AppData
) jelentős lemezterületet foglalhatnak el. Ezek manuális tisztításával (előzetes tájékozódás után!) sok gigabájt helyet spórolhatunk. - Fejlett testreszabás: Bizonyos játékok és alkalmazások konfigurációs fájljai rejtett mappákban találhatók. Ezek szerkesztésével egyedi beállításokat, modokat alkalmazhatunk.
- Adatok mentése vagy áttelepítése: Egy régi Windows telepítésről menthetjük a programok egyedi beállításait az
AppData
mappából, hogy egy új rendszerre való átálláskor ne kelljen mindent újra konfigurálni. - Malware eltávolítás: A rosszindulatú programok gyakran rejtett mappákba ágyazzák be magukat, hogy elkerüljék a felfedezést. A rejtett fájlok megjelenítésével segíthetjük a vírusirtó programok munkáját, vagy manuálisan is azonosíthatjuk és eltávolíthatjuk a fertőzött elemeket (nagyon óvatosan!).
Fontos biztonsági megfontolások
A „láthatatlan könyvtárak” felfedezése és módosítása nagy hatalommal jár, és ezzel együtt nagy felelősséggel is. Tartsa szem előtt a következőket:
- Ne töröljön semmit, amit nem ismer! A rendszerfájlok vagy programadatok véletlen törlése a Windows összeomlását vagy az alkalmazások működésképtelenségét okozhatja. Ha bizonytalan, keressen rá az adott fájlra vagy mappára az interneten, mielőtt bármit is tesz.
- Készítsen biztonsági mentést! Mielőtt bármilyen komolyabb módosítást végezne egy rejtett mappában, készítsen biztonsági másolatot a szóban forgó fájlokról vagy mappákról. A Windows Rendszer-visszaállítási pont is hasznos lehet.
- Legyen óvatos a hozzáférési jogokkal! Egyes rejtett mappákhoz különleges jogosultságok szükségesek. Ne módosítsa a jogosultságokat, hacsak nem biztos abban, hogy mit csinál, mert ezzel sértheti a rendszer biztonságát.
- Malware veszély: A rejtett attribútumot a kártevők is előszeretettel használják az álcázásra. Ha furcsa rejtett fájlokat talál, ellenőrizze őket vírusirtóval.
Összefoglalás
A Windows „láthatatlan könyvtárai” sok felhasználó számára ismeretlen területet jelentenek, pedig kulcsfontosságúak az operációs rendszer stabilitása és funkcionalitása szempontjából. Bár a Windows alapértelmezés szerint elrejti ezeket az elemeket a véletlen módosításoktól, a fejlettebb felhasználók számára elengedhetetlen lehet, hogy tudják, hogyan férjenek hozzájuk és hogyan kezeljék őket.
Az itt leírt módszerekkel – legyen szó a Fájlkezelő beállításairól, a parancssorról vagy a PowerShellről – teljes kontrollt szerezhetünk a rejtett fájlok felett. Ne feledje azonban: a tudatos és óvatos kezelés a legfontosabb. Fedezze fel bátran, de mindig tartsa szem előtt a biztonsági előírásokat, és csak akkor avatkozzon be, ha biztos a dolgában. Így a „láthatatlan könyvtárak” nem rejtélyt, hanem a Windows mélyebb megértését szolgáló hasznos eszközöket jelentik majd Önnek.